Code C0890 GMC Description
What are the Possible Causes of the DTC C0890 GMC?
- Faulty Brake Pedal Position Sensor
- Brake Pedal Position Sensor harness is open or shorted
- Brake Pedal Position Sensor circuit poor electrical connection
- Faulty Body Control Module (BCM)
How to Fix the DTC C0890 GMC?
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?
Labor: 1.0
To diagnose the C0890 GMC code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80β$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.
